随笔 - 54  文章 - 0  评论 - 184  阅读 - 58万
08 2013 档案
C++临时变量的生命周期
摘要:C++ 中的临时变量指的是那些由编译器根据需要在栈上产生的,没有名字的变量。主要的用途主要有两类:1) 函数的返回值, 如: 1 string proc() 2 { 3 return string("abc"); 4 } 5 6 int main() 7 { 8 proc()... 阅读全文
posted @ 2013-08-11 21:29 twoon 阅读(15431) 评论(5) 推荐(3) 编辑
实现无锁的栈与队列(4)
摘要:现在我们来尝试解决前一篇文章提到的问题。(一)首先是内存释放的问题。这个问题乍看起来很棘手:我们现在要访问一段内存,但却不知道这段内存是否还合法,是否已被释放。怎么办呢?很直接的一个想法是,看看有没别的方式可以检查该内存是否还合法,这个想法很单纯,但从前面几篇文章的讨论我们得知,任何时候直接去碰队列... 阅读全文
posted @ 2013-08-08 22:26 twoon 阅读(5853) 评论(6) 推荐(5) 编辑

<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5

点击右上角即可分享
微信分享提示